On 2016-08-13 21:04, Manish Jain wrote:
> ... there is no way to determine in advance=20
> whether certain hardware will work on not. It should not be difficult t=
o=20
> put up a web page which lists hardware compatibility ratings for the=20
> most popular hardware available online. Since things like CPU, disk=20
> drives, memory modules, monitor, keyboard and mouse always work, as a=20
> desktop user, I only need hardware compatibility scores for graphics=20
> adapter, sound card, ethernet adapter, printer/scanner. If I could=20
> easily see which currently available adapter/card/printer is supported,=
=20
> it makes life easier for everyone - for me buying the hardware, for=20
> FreeBSD users looking to support the OS and the hardware it runs on.

At leasr for graphics such a web page which lists hardware compatibility
exists:
https://wiki.freebsd.org/Graphics#Video_cards

> This also becomes a strong incentive to hardware manufacturers to ensur=
e=20
> that their hardware works on FreeBSD; ...

Nearly all hardware manufacturers don't give a tinker's damn about FreeBS=
D.

> ... Richland graphics don't work. ...

Richland has Northern Islands and Northern Islands should work.

> ... there is not even a single nvidia
> card ... which I can see mentioned as supported
> on the FreeBSD Graphics web page. The only cards listed there are ages =

> old and possibly very expensive cards. Not even a single card with the =

> current bunch of 210/610/710/730 chipsets is referred on that page.=20

This page is for open source drivers.
nvidia cards are supported by the proprietary driver from nvidia:
http://www.geforce.com/drivers/results/105346
